Output 57ac98bf5db00ac367ebe2f64e784100bdb4df2856d2a353d0781663a602ec40: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a8bf7fc2508910b9b614ba308680e0a436d6dd2 OP_EQUAL
address
32enMf589TqZmzP8pU35LiDHoi3os9Vosn
transaction
57ac98bf5db00ac367ebe2f64e784100bdb4df2856d2a353d0781663a602ec40
confirmations
396567
spent
true